To the release manager: I'm passing ownership of the Pellwick deep-link router to Sorrel before the 4.2 cut. The intent-matching table now lives in the Farrowgate config service; stale entries were purged last sprint. Watch the fallback route — it silently swallows malformed slugs, which inflated our drop-off metrics in March. The staging resolver needs its keystore unlocked before each regression pass, and that keystore accepts only one credential. For the signing vault, the recovery phrase is noted directly below.

recovery phrase for tafog-fafog: novix-novdor-fraath-brieth-olieth-oliix-rusix-wenion-julax-druox

Subject: Handover — EXIF scrubbing pipeline

Hi Verna,

Handing over the Pictave EXIF scrubber before my leave. Every upload passes through the strip worker, which removes GPS and device tags prior to storage; the audit table logs original tag counts for compliance review. The worker retries twice on failure and quarantines anything unreadable. It writes audit rows to the metadata database using the connection string below.

primary connection of tajeg-tajop = postgresql://julax_svc:DI@db-e7f3.kelvidyn.corp:5432/rusdor

Hey Tomas,

Welcome aboard the Furrowlink rotation! Quick heads-up before Thursday's eng sync: the telemetry gateway for the harvester fleet has been dropping packets when combine units reconnect after long offline stretches. It's not urgent, but it pages occasionally at night, so know the restart dance. I'll walk through the gnarly bits at the sync. Meanwhile, the escalation flow and dashboards are documented on the internal page below.

operations page: https://jenkins.zemvarcloud.local/job/merge_requests/repo/build/73930b4b30f0a8ed

Welcome to Marrowgate Tower. On weekends, the lift contractor Velstrum Engineering services cars A and B between 07:00 and 13:00, so only car C runs. Plan deliveries accordingly and use the east stairwell if car C is busy. The stairwell doors lock from the inside on weekends for security. If you need weekend access to the floors, unlock the stairwell keypads with the staff code below.

door code, yagap-bahof: bdg-O-05